Question: I am getting all neg pregnancy tests. Including many on the low sensitivity first response early test. 40 days late and I am a healthy 23 year old woman. I also always used condoms and had sex only 2 times before the first missed period. and I am not trying to conceive. I have no symptoms at all. I have also been under a lot of stress lately because of a move across state and financial issues. Could I still be pregnant?

Brief Answer: Not pregnant... Detailed Answer: Hi, From what your are mentioning, most probably you are not pregnant. If you would be, it would have been already shown in the tests by now. Being under a lot of stress could have caused delayed periods. I suggest to: - get an ultrasound to rule out any pathology - get your blood hormones measured (progesterone) Hope it helped!
